We're in Romans 1:18–3:20What happens when we exchange God's truth for something else?In Week 2 of our Rooted & Sent: Romans Study, we explore one of the most challenging—and relevant—passages in the book of Romans. Paul reveals what happens when people suppress truth, pursue idols, and look to created things for identity, purpose, and fulfillment instead of the Creator.In a culture that encourages us to "follow our hearts," define our own truth, and seek validation from the world around us, Romans reminds us that anything we place above God will ultimately leave us empty.
